Transaction f0816f72322258ac97c70d6cd862e2b0783d51e94fc8a2209fbfa7983142d80b
2 Input
1 Outputs
- f0816f72322258ac97c70d6cd862e2b0783d51e94fc8a2209fbfa7983142d80b:0
value 17746
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G